Einstein's Greatest Mistake: The Life of a Flawed Genius
David Bodanis
From the bestselling author of E=mc², Einstein's Greatest Mistake is a brisk, accessible biography of Albert Einstein that reveals the genius and hubris of the titan of modern science.
